Transaction 44a8fdc62118bacfd832bf4fc51684e6f02b14782db11d694e938047839bbc8a

1 Input
2 Outputs
  • 44a8fdc62118bacfd832bf4fc51684e6f02b14782db11d694e938047839bbc8a:0
  • value  25722580
    address  1CitYLgrPaQKoF81okPZyuxCbHaVrKDw95
  • 44a8fdc62118bacfd832bf4fc51684e6f02b14782db11d694e938047839bbc8a:1
  • value  1104761663
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n